Job summary

The interview date for this role will be 28th September 2023.

As Senior Phlebotomist you would be supervising and ensuring the smooth running of 2 Phlebotomy sites- at B.D.G.H and the Community Diagnostic Centre located in Barnsley town centre.

They will have extensive knowledge and experience of all duties and competences required of a Phlebotomist. The post holder will supervise the team in the day to day running of the service.

Main duties of the job

To ensure all phlebotomy staff perform their duties safely and effectively to a high quality.

Provide help to other team members in times of difficulty/need where it is felt the support of a Senior is required.

Organization of staff rotas and plan annual leave/absence cover where required.

The post holder will be responsible for arranging all mandatory competence-based training requirements for their team.

Deliver the practical element of the Trusts Venepuncture training package and mentor through their training all newly appointed staff.

Record and deal with any service user comments/complaints accordingly.

Assist in the investigation of complaints as required.

Day to day organizational responsibilities of the Phlebotomy team, reporting any anomalies to the Phlebotomy Service Manager or other appropriate Manager.

In addition to these duties the post holder will share responsibility to deputise for the Phlebotomy Services Manager as required in their absence.

Person Specification

Experience

Essential

  • Experience of working with the public.
  • Experience of the Health Care setting.
  • Roster management experience.
  • Have experience and clear understanding of the requirements of all areas of phlebotomy covered by Pathology.
  • Health and safety risk management training.

Knowledge and Awareness

Essential

  • Manual dexterity.
  • Understanding of team members needs with regards to support required.
  • Ability to work under pressure and to tight deadlines.
  • Ability to pay attention to detail.
  • Ability to work as a team but also with minimal supervision when required.
  • Willing to undertake any further training as and when required to extend this role.

Trust Values

Essential

  • In around 100 words please describe what Equality & Diversity means to you and why they are important.
  • In around 100 words please describe how you would contribute to a well functioning team.

Qualifications

Essential

  • Have undertaken and been deemed competent in the theory and practical training of venepuncture and have practised regular venepuncture for the last 3 years.
